In G.K. Chesterton's "The Everlasting Man (Unabridged)", readers are taken on a profound journey through the history of mankind's spiritual and religious development. This influential work combines historical analysis with Chesterton's signature wit and contemplative style, making it a must-read for those interested in theology and philosophical discussions. The book reflects Chesterton's deep understanding of theology and his ability to present complex ideas in an accessible and engaging manner, making it a timeless piece of literature that continues to inspire readers to this day. Chesterton's exploration of the relationship between religion and humanity provides readers with thought-provoking insights and challenges conventional views on the evolution of faith and belief systems. The Everlasting Man is a captivating and enlightening read that will leave readers pondering the mysteries of existence and the eternal quest for spiritual truth.
